Kazushi Ueda is a scholar working on Geometry and Topology, Mathematical Physics and Algebra and Number Theory. According to data from OpenAlex, Kazushi Ueda has authored 74 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 42 papers in Geometry and Topology, 23 papers in Mathematical Physics and 13 papers in Algebra and Number Theory. Recurrent topics in Kazushi Ueda’s work include Algebraic structures and combinatorial models (29 papers), Algebraic Geometry and Number Theory (16 papers) and Homotopy and Cohomology in Algebraic Topology (14 papers). Kazushi Ueda is often cited by papers focused on Algebraic structures and combinatorial models (29 papers), Algebraic Geometry and Number Theory (16 papers) and Homotopy and Cohomology in Algebraic Topology (14 papers).
